#3b0895 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b0895 is composed of 23.1% red, 3.1%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.4% cyan, 94.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 261.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 30.8%. #3b0895 color hex could be obtained by blending #7610ff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#3b0895
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f3ecf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b0895
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4a53 is the less saturated color, while #39029b is the most saturated one.
